John Singleton Copley

John Singleton Copley (1738–1815) was an American-born painter active in colonial Boston and later in London. The foremost portrait artist of the American Revolution era, he captured leading figures including Paul Revere and Samuel Adams with penetrating realism. After relocating to England in 1774, he continued his success as a portraitist while also painting ambitious historical scenes depicting modern subjects and dress.
